Direct message the job poster from EMEA Recruitment Consultant – HR Division in Switzerland – EMEA Recruitment is partnering with a multinational business in their search for a Senior HR Manager. This position will be based in Basel, the ideal candidate will need to commit to a minimum of 3 days per week in the office. We are looking for a driven professional with a mix of HR managerial and Business Partnering experience in a multi-national environment to undertake the responsibility of leading business-wide initiatives and projects. You will be part of an exciting business who are looking to enter a strong growth and transformational phase, acting as a key member to this. Key responsibilities of the Senior HR Manager: Define the HR function through partnering with both local and global teams Development of HR processes and strategies including implementation of new initiatives and optimisation of current processes Collaborate cross-functionally with the finance department to coordinate budgeting and planning Oversight and responsibility of the full employee lifecycle as well as driving employer branding, succession planning, talent management and cultural development Proven experience in Human Resources roles in German-speaking environments, with a deep understanding of German labor laws, HR regulations, and cultural nuances in employee management. Required skills/experience: Strong stakeholder management and communication skills at varying levels and geographical regions Prior experience in improving processes and initiating change High level knowledge of and desire to manage the full employee life cycle Proficient in English and German is mandatory If you are interested in applying for this Senior HR Manager role, please register your interest using the link below.
